Lindsey Batson, an A+ student from Princeton, MO, has been selected as North Central Missouri College’s Outstanding Student for December 2021. Lindsey is a sophomore working toward her Associate in Arts degree. After graduating in May from NCMC, Lindsey plans to transfer her associate’s degree to the University of Missouri-Columbia to obtain a degree in sports management.  

Lindsey is an athlete on the NCMC women’s softball team and residence assistance for the women’s dorm. She is also involved with the Digital Media Team. Lindsey’s favorite class has been Art Appreciation with Instructor Jim Norris. Lindsey said, “I liked learning about artists and the history behind each painting. I enjoy art, and the class was really interesting to me.”

Lindsey went on to say, “NCMC is a great place for a smaller college feel. I came from a small high school, and it was very comfortable for me to attend NCMC. It’s been the right move; I’ve met some of my best friends at NCMC.”

Each month, a student is nominated by a faculty or staff member to be featured as an Outstanding Student based on their dedication to educational success, attitude toward learning, and hard work in their field and activities.
